In this video, we discussed how to create a functional component in React and the advantages of functional components over class components. What are the reasons developers/programmers prefer to use functional components over class components in React?
Below are some reasons to use the functional component over react class component:
1. Functional components are much easier to read and test because they are plain JavaScript functions without state or lifecycle hooks you end up with less code.
2. It will get easier to separate container and presentational components because you need to think more about your component’s state if you don’t have access to setState() in your component.
3. The React team mentioned that there may be a performance boost for the functional components in future React versions.
4. There is one difference in the syntax. A functional component is just a plain JavaScript function that accepts props as an argument and returns a React element. A class component requires you to extend from React.Component and create a render function that returns a React element. This requires more code but will also give some benefits.
If you want to know more about the actual differences between the functional and class component then you can visit our tutorial on https://codezup.com/functional-vs-cla...
Also if you want to know how to create a table in React JS application with functional components then you can visit • Create Dynamic Customised Table in Re...
Смотрите видео Best Way to Create Functional Component in Modern React JS Example онлайн без регистрации, длительностью часов минут секунд в хорошем качестве. Это видео добавил пользователь Codez Up 30 Сентябрь 2022, не забудьте поделиться им ссылкой с друзьями и знакомыми, на нашем сайте его посмотрели 107 раз и оно понравилось 1 людям.